As noted before, Maria Kanellis announced this past July that a mass was recently discovered on her adrenal gland and underwent surgery this past week for retroperitoneoscopic adrenalectomy.
Kanellis provided an update earlier today stating that she was re-admitted to the hospital due to health issues related to her recent surgery.
“Spent the night in the emergency room receiving different cocktails of drugs including anti-nausea, morphine, caffeine/ibuprofen, magnesium, etc trying to make me comfortable. Then, they re-admitted me this morning because they could not control the pain, at 4:00am. I’m having trouble walking and standing because of the pain. I miss my kids and I am ready to be home but here I am.”
